UK unemployment shows surprise fall to 4.9% as pay growth drops to lowest in five years
UK unemployment unexpectedly fell to 4.9% in the three months to February, while wage growth dropped to a five-year low of 3.6%. However, economists warn that the Iran war and rising energy costs are likely to weaken hiring and increase job cuts in the coming months.
